These are the historical kernel patches that added lzma1 support to Squashfs. These patches were rejected for the mainline kernel in 2010, and so lzma1 support for Squashfs was abandoned. I have put these patches back up on kernel.org as a service to owners that have embedded systems that use these legacy lzma1 compressed Squashfs filesystems. Their use is deprecated for anything else. The kernel version is 2.6.33-rc4 which was the kernel the patches were prepared and tested against. I have no idea if the patches will compile and work on later kernels.
